Executive Summary

The Director of Labor Relations & Professional Standards, on behalf of the Superintendent of Schools, hereby provides the Board an update with the FLEHT participation process for a future decision for the Board for addressing health care costs for the 2027 calendar year for employees. The presentation will review the timeline to plan for and decide about whether to become self-insured for the 2027 calendar year. A representative from FLEHT will provide a short presentation and answer any questions for the Board. FLEHT provided an update to the insurance committee on April 29, 2026. The Board maintains a parallel process with Florida Blue who will provide the Board a fully insured quote and a quote about becoming a third-party agent or ASO should a decision be made by the Board to go fully insured.
